Pandemic triggers 'widespread upheaval' in global fisheries and aquaculture

The United Nations

COVID-19 has caused "widespread upheaval" for the whole fishing and aquaculture industry around the world, the UN deputy agriculture chief said on Tuesday, launching a new report that assesses the toll the pandemic has taken on the sector.

"Production has been disrupted, supply chains have been interrupted and consumer spending restricted by various lockdowns", said Maria Helena Semedo, Deputy Director-General of the Food and Agriculture Organization (FAO).

And as containment restraints continue to affect supply and demand, further interference may impact the sector throughout the year, according to FAO's The impact of COVID-19 on fisheries and aquaculture food systems report.
